俄罗斯岩石科学的进展和问题
作者姓名:Marakushev.A.A.
作者单位:Moscow state University,Moscow,Russia,119899
摘    要:最主要进展是把岩石学研究扩大至天体,形成了天体岩石学研究方向。以陨石、月岩、彗星及宇宙尘为主要对象,运用地球化学天体化学观点,研究太阳系行星的起源和演化,并推衍于地球内生作用,指出行星的更生(renovation)过程有三种类型:裂谷作用、成岛(nesogenesis)和造山作用。文中对裂谷岩浆作用、碱性岩浆(在成岛阶段)演化作了论述,提出金刚石成因四大类型。认为金伯利岩钾镁煌斑岩中金刚石成矿是承袭被取代的母岩高压成矿的产物,变质杂岩中金刚石来自卷入其中的含金刚石橄榄岩、辉石岩和榴辉岩,金刚石的高 ̄3He/ ̄4He比值排除其为变质成因,金刚石成因新解释提出了金刚石成矿预测的新思路。含金刚石环状构造并非陨石冲击所成而是火山强力爆发的产物,各类球粒陨石中都发现过金刚石,说明球粒陨石来自巨型行星熔融核心,其流体外壳的压力足以生成金刚石。地球与太阳系其它星体之差别在于存在地槽体制、火山沉积岩系褶皱及其造山演化过程。

关 键 词:天体岩石学,行星的更生作用,裂谷岩浆作用,碱性岩浆作用,金刚石成矿作用

ADVANCES AND PROBLEMS IN THE PETROLOGICAL SCIENCE IN RUSSIA
Marakushev.A.A..ADVANCES AND PROBLEMS IN THE PETROLOGICAL SCIENCE IN RUSSIA[J].Earth Science Frontiers,1994(Z1).
Authors:MarakushevAA
Abstract:The principal step forward is the widening of petrological studies on extrater-restrial objects,resulted in the new scientific trend,named Cosmic Petrology.Renovationprocess on planets are complicatelso it can only schematically be reduced to 3 types:theriftogenesis,the nesogenesis and the orogenesis,The riftogenic magmatism and the pro-cess of the alkaline magmatism at nesogenesis stage are elaborated.Four types of diamondmineralization are discussed.The lamproites and kimberlites themselves do not containtheir own high-bar mineralization.They inherited the high pressure intratelluric mantlematerials including diamond from their parent rocks during the replacement processes.The diamonds in metamorphic complexes are not metamorphic origin,The dimonds remainonly as inclusions in relic granites,clinopyroxenites and zircons.High(solar)ratio of3He/4He excludes their metamorphic formation,The interpretation of the diamond genesisin metamorphic complexes widens radically perspectives of the diamond prospecting, Newconceptions on diamond ring structures are proposed.The meteoric hypothesis of their ori-gin should be repudiated;however,the hypothesis of great-power bursts caused by pro-cesses of general degasing of the Earth is better accepted.The discovery of diamonds invarious types of chondrites has significantly widened our notion on the genesis of dia-monds.According to these notions,the chondritic matter was formed initially in the melt-ed cores of giant planets,Under the high pressure of their fluid shells the diamonds areformed.The Earth’s specificity among all other planets of the solar system are also brieflydiscussed at the end of the present paper.
Keywords:cosmic petrology  renovation process on planets  riftogenic magmatism  alka-line magmatism  diamond mineralization
